Obituary for Pat Simpson Sr.

Pat   Simpson Sr.
Pat Simpson Sr., age 86, of Casey, IL passed away on Sunday, February 26, 2017 at Heartland Nursing Center, Casey, IL. He was born April 30, 1930 in Hoguetown, Clark County, IL the youngest child of Milo and Pearl Nash Simpson. He retired from Marathon Pipeline Company in 1986 with 37 years of service. He was a member of Masonic Lodge #603 of Martinsville for over 50 years.

Survivors include his wife, the former Ada Napier; daughters, Sandra (Chuck) Hires of Deland, FL and Nancy (Bud) Followell of Shelburn, IN; sons, Pat (Cindy) Simpson Jr. of Casey, IL and Scott (Karen) Simpson of Jacksonville, FL; grandsons Kyle Simpson of Casey, Brandon (Veronica) Simpson and great granddaughter Layka Simpson of Marshall, IL; step granddaughter, Shannon Kramer of Fort Myers, FL; step great granddaughters, Ashley McDaniel of Ft Myers, FL, and Jessica Massey of Gray, TN.

He was preceded in death by daughter, Terri, his parents; brothers, Tom, Lloyd, Gerald, Woodie, John and Leon and sisters, Helen Templin, Ruth Bays, Eliza Ruley, Myrtle Bowen, Inez Garrett and nieces and nephews.
Before his health failed, Pat enjoyed traveling, spending time in Florida in the winter months, playing golf and gardening. He was a good husband, father and grandfather and will be sadly missed.

Funeral services will be conducted at 10:30 am on Wednesday, March 1, 2017, at Markwell Funeral Home with Rev. Billie Ray Ulrey officiating. Burial will follow in the Ridgelawn Cemetery, Martinsville, IL. Visitation will be held on Tuesday evening from 4 to 7 p.m. at Markwell Funeral Home, 200 N. Central Ave., Casey, IL.
